The river carried your name through evening light,
Soft winds wandered across the quiet land,
Wild flowers opened their gentle hearts,
As nature held my soul within its hand.
The trees stood still beneath the painted sky,
Their leaves moved softly with a tender grace,
I felt your love within the silent breeze,
Like sunlight resting warmly on my face.
The distant hills wore shades of fading gold,
Birdsongs floated through the endless air,
Each sound became a secret song of love,
A melody that followed everywhere.
The moon arrived with silver in its hands,
Stars gathered softly in the peaceful night,
I saw your memory dancing in the dark,
Turning every shadow into light.
Beneath the trees where quiet moments bloom,
The earth and sky seemed woven into one,
My heart still keeps your whisper close within,
Like nature holding love that stays undone.

Poet's note: I wrote Whispers Beneath the Trees during a quiet evening when nature felt deeply alive and peaceful. The idea came from imagining a moment where someone sits beneath trees while watching the sunset, listening to the river and wind, and remembering a person they love. I did not write it for one specific person. Instead, I wrote it for anyone who has felt love become part of the world around them, where memories and emotions seem to appear in every small detail of nature.
The feelings I wanted to express were love, peace, longing, and warmth. I wanted love to feel soft rather than dramatic, like a gentle breeze touching leaves or moonlight resting on the earth. The poem carries the feeling of missing someone while also feeling comforted by their presence in memories and in nature itself.
To me, this poem represents the way love can exist beyond words and distance. Sometimes people are not beside us, yet we still find them in places, sounds, and moments. The river, flowers, trees, moon, and stars symbolize the idea that nature quietly keeps emotions alive. The poem reminds me that love is not always loud. Sometimes it is found in silence, in memories, and in the peaceful beauty of the world around us.
